The Duty of Medicare in Senior Citizen Medical Care



As people age, Medicare plays a pivotal function in sustaining their medical care requires by providing essential protection for a variety of medical solutions. Developed in 1965, Medicare is a government program developed especially for senior citizens and specific younger individuals with specials needs. It encompasses various components, including Part A, which covers hospital keeps, and Part B, which concentrates on outpatient care and preventative services.Medicare likewise uses Component D, a prescription medication plan, helping elders take care of drug prices. This comprehensive insurance coverage substantially reduces the economic problem linked with medical care expenditures, making certain that elders obtain essential treatments without prohibitive out-of-pocket prices. On top of that, Medicare Advantage prepares provide additional options, including vision and oral insurance coverage, which boost total wellness monitoring. By facilitating access to health care services, Medicare not just promotes far better health and wellness results however additionally contributes to the general wellness and satisfaction for elders steering with their golden years.

Key Enrollment Dates



Comprehending essential registration days is vital for seniors looking to safeguard the ideal insurance protection. The Medicare Open Enrollment Period, which occurs every year from October 15 to December 7, permits elders to review and adjust their protection choices. Throughout this time around, individuals can enroll in, button, or decrease strategies without penalty. In addition, senior citizens ought to recognize the Preliminary Enrollment Period, which lasts for seven months, beginning three months prior to they turn 65. For those qualified for Medicaid, enrollment is readily available year-round; however, particular target dates may use for certain programs. Recognizing these days warranties that senior citizens can maximize available benefits and avoid prospective gaps in coverage. Prompt action during these periods is imperative for optimal health and economic protection.
